So, what is stereotactic technology?
Stereotactic surgery uses the principles of stereotactic geotry to establish a brain coordinate system and install a locator on the skull, establishing the coordinate system to target the brain’s structural targets, guiding surgical tools like microelectrodes, biopsy needles, and lesion needles to the target point for operations.
It sounds complex, but simply put, it makes cranial surgery more accurate to the point of "hit where you aim"!
Moreover, with the precise positioning of 3D-slicer technology, this makes those complex neurosurgeries much more possible.
For instance, current stereotactic surgery is primarily used in treating Parkinson’s disease, tumors, epilepsy, and other brain disorders in the field of neurosurgery. It also has good efficacy in emotional conditions, especially severe ntal illnesses!
